令人惊艳的珠宝设计很多,但是惊艳到可以让人为之震撼的,却少之又少。但是看过Dior Joaillerie 推出的最新系列国王与王后“Kings and Queens”,你绝对会过目不忘! 由Victoire de Castellane 设计的最新迪奥“国王与王后”宝石系列,在时尚圈一经推出就狂受追捧,很多时尚评论家都赞叹道,这不仅只是个珠宝系列,更是珠宝艺术的体现! 戒指的整体是由各色珍贵石体,包括玉石,蛋白石,黑曜石和石英石精雕细琢成骷髅头造型,外镶迪奥设计工坊的皇冠造型,具有着极高的收藏价值。
|
新美国媒体当地时间17日公布了一份有关少数族裔女性移民调查报告中的细节,暴露了女性移民移民前后职业上的反差,以及她们对美国籍的态度。这份调查报告首次披露了各少数族裔女性移民中,非法移民的比率。 根据这份题为《女性移民:21世纪的家庭管家》的调查报告,华裔女性来美后面临工作难找、个人收入偏低、医疗健保及语言障碍等问题,但她们同时也认为,美国社会较包容,仅有13%的华裔女性认为对移民的歧视是社会一大问题。在家庭角色方面,71%的受访者表示她们来美后,在家中更加果断及自信。 报道指出,新美国媒体共采访了1002位各族裔女性移民,包括100名来自中国的女性移民。她们当中,18-34岁者8人,35-49岁者27人,50-64岁者45人,65岁以上者24人。 接受采访的女性移民中,大多数人在回答“来美后最大挑战”的问题时,都选择了“协助子女成功”和“维持家庭团聚”。这份报告也指出,少数族裔女性移民在经济和就业方面面临巨大挑战。 报告显示,华裔女性移民前后在就业方面存在很大反差:有49%在移民前是职业妇女,有51%从事“其他工作”。后者包括旅馆服务生、餐馆侍应生、工厂技工、家庭清洁工和衣厂工人等。而她们来美后,则仅有24%的人是职业妇女,另外76%的人只能做“其他工作”。 在华裔女性中,有40%的人是单独来美的,有60%的人是跟随家人一同来美的。在亚裔女性中,华裔单独来美的女性比率排第二位。在对“来美主要目的”一项的回答中,有20%的华裔女性表示,是为了“获得更高学历”,在以受教育为目的来美的亚裔女性移民中华裔比率最高。 在受访华裔女性中,有50%的人愿意成为美国公民,有14%的人仍愿保留母国国籍,有36%的人回答不知道或未提供答案。在同类亚裔移民中,华裔女性有意愿入籍的比率最低,意愿最高的是越裔,达91%。 在回答入籍目的这一问题时,32%的华裔女性表示是为了终身留在美国,有23%的人是为了永远不和孩子分开,有5%的人是为了更好的工作。 在回答是否是合法居民或是无身份居民问题时,91%的华裔女性回答是合法居民,有5%的人回答是无身份居民,另有4%未提供答案。亚裔中,华裔女性回答是无身份居民者所占比率最高。在所有少数族裔女性移民中,无身份移民比率为35%,其中拉丁裔最高,达37%。 |
需求:业务逻辑在处理数据时,需要返回Message并阻止程序的继续运行。但是,在存储过程使用Oracle数据库的Raise根本无法满足现在的要求。
使用RAISE_APPLICATION_ERROR RAISE_APPLICATION_ERROR ( error_number_in IN NUMBER, error_msg_in IN VARCHAR2); error_number: 自定义的错误编号。 error_msg:自定义的错误内容。 在使用的过程中,你可能会遇到了下面的问题。 ORA-21000: error number argument to raise_application_error of [xxxx] is out of range 出现此错误的原因如下: 在存储过程中定义的错误代码Number其实并不在Oracle数据库所允许的范围之内。因为Oracle数据库允许自定义的错误代码的范围是-20000 -- -20999 这样,就在Java端可以通过SQLException来捕获异常。 虽然通过SQLException.getMessage()可以捕获到异常的内容,但是这些内容对于开发比较有用。对于客户来说,并不友好,也没有多大意义。 通过SQLException.getErrorCode()可以捕获到自定义的异常错误编号。然后我们就可以通过这个错误编号,自定义相应的Message内容,返回给客户。 下面我们来介绍另一种解决方法: 通过存储过程返回值,你可以直接把错误Message定义在返回值中间。在Java端解析后,可以直接取得Message代码。 示例如下: If condition then p_result := 'ERR:MSG2061'; end if; if substr(p_result, 1, 3) = 'ERR' then ROLLBACK; else p_result = 'OK'; end if; Java:略去中间的调用存储过程的步骤 if(result != null && result.startsWith("ERR:")) // 从result中解析出Message_id,显示Message到前台 |
© 2024 Jinbay.com All rights reserved.
版权所有金海湾。 未经许可,不得转载。